A data governance tool helps organizations to manage their data assets. It involves the creation and management of an centralized database of metadata about an organization’s data assets, and automating processes to enforce policies and ensure quality. It also involves creating procedures for collecting and analyzing the data, identifying any gaps and suggesting solutions. Data governance is a crucial aspect of a company’s data management strategy. It provides value for business users and supports their goals for digital transformation.
The most popular tools for managing data are Collibra, Erwin Data Governance (formerly erwin Data Intelligence), Informatica and Talend. Each of these tools provides various features that include data catalogs and policy management and visualization of data lineage. Collibra also offers a data jumpstart, which will help organizations speed up their data governance, MDM, and other projects.
Other important features include data stewardship workflow automation, a data glossary and metadata management. Utilizing these features, a business can create a common language and improve collaboration with other teams in the organization. It can streamline tasks and ensure that governance practices are regularly updated when the business’s needs change.
Other key functionality that some of the most effective data governance tools offer is data privacy capabilities, which allow businesses to classify and protect personal information while making sure that they are in compliance with privacy laws. These tools also detect and flag any potential threats to data, assisting to deal with security breaches and other issues.
